What are Pain clinics?

Pain clinics are also called pain management clinics; these clinics are equipped with all the health care facilities that help to diagnose and cure the pain. The pains are categorized as chronic & acute pains. The acute pain refers to the one which lasts up to 3 to 6 months, which heals as the injured tissues heal. Whereas the chronic pains are a bit more severe than acute pain, they can last up to a week, month, or even years and continues to hurt even after the injury heals. Chronic pains affect your daily activities and mental health to a great extent. Remember the difference between the inter-disciplinary and the normal pain clinics. Multi-disciplinary clinic tends to look at the whole person, unlike the pain clinics. Whereas, Pain clinics are built to heal the chronic pains and focus on the treatment of chronic pains like neck and back pain.

What Do these Pain Clinics Consist Of?
The pain clinic teams consist of nurses, doctors, psychologists, physical therapists, nutritionists, dietitians, occupational therapists, and vocational therapists.

What Are Pain Physicians and What To Expect From Them?

Pain physicians are also called pain specialists or pain experts, and they help to cure, prevent, and treat chronic pains. Each pain physician has a different educational background and is an expert in his/her field. Pain physicians are doctors from any specialty, for example, family practice, neurology, cardiology, emergency pains, surgeons, obstetrician, and others. The main goal of a pain management doctor is to cut your pain and improve the quality of your life. They help you learn and cope with your pain, thus making you more active and perform your day to day activities more actively.

A pain management doctor is a specialist with specialized training that has the capability to treat your pain. If you go to any pain management doctor, you should expect him/her to have all the specialized knowledge about your pain and be able to treat even the most complicated pains. He/ she must be able to understand your condition and suggest a quick treatment to manage your pain. Support you morally to cope with your suffering and suggest the best medication. He/she must help you to learn more about the skills such as the nerve blocking, spinal injections, and other techniques. The pain management doctor must be well aware of the modern pain treatments, complex drugs (their uses, effects, and side effects), safety measures, and the knowledge of modern day therapies.
The pain management specialists play a vital role in organizing additional physical theories and rehabilitation programs in order to offer his/her patients multiple ways to cure their chronic/acute pains.

What Should You Look For In The Pain Management Doctor?

The first and most important thing is to find the most relevant and expert doctor that has years of experience and training. The doctors should be friendly and listen to your entire problems whole heartedly. It is better if the doctor has additional training after his school education in pain management. These fellowships are of a year or so. He/she must have the experience to deal with the interdisciplinary pains. You should ask them if they are certified. Which procedures and techniques do they use to cure the pains? In case they are unable to cure the pain, which surgeons and psychologists do they refer to?

What is their overall goal and crisis management system?

On your first visit, you should expect your doctor to know all about your pain and figure out the ways to deal with it. It involves a medical history, complete medical examination, and test reviews. On your first visit, you are probably to ask for bringing your medical test results such as X-ray, CAT scans, & MRI scans. Your pain management doctor should analyze your pain problems and discuss the treatment thoroughly before proceeding with the therapy. No matter what your pain issue is, the first visit to your physician should always be about the discussion and understanding of your pain, evaluation, and treatment.
